// Support note: ENC_SNIFF_BYTES controls how much of an uploaded
// text file Plumeleaf reads to guess encoding. Raising it fixed the
// mis-detected Latin-1 invoices customers reported; lowering it will
// bring those tickets back. Do not change without rerunning the
// encoding fixture suite. The validated build carrying this value
// is identified by the token below.

trace token, kahog-tajeg: htk6_97d963

## Deployment

Validator plugins for Gatecheck load from the plugins directory at boot. Each plugin must export a `validate` hook and declare a schema version; mismatched versions are skipped with a warning, not an error. Restart the worker pool after adding or removing plugins — hot reload is not supported yet. Run the smoke suite before merging. The runtime resolves plugin paths and limits from the configuration below.

settings of tagef-bawif:
DRUIX_HOST=druix.zemvarlabs.internal
DRUIX_PORT=8000

- [ ] Step 7: Archive cold storage buckets (Glacierline tier). Confirm both ceremony witnesses are present, verify bucket manifests match the Oxbow ledger, then seal the archive key shares. Plugin authors may observe but not handle shares. Once sealed, the archive index itself is encrypted and can only be reopened with the passphrase below.

vault phrase of badup-hahig = tamael-aldael-kelmir-istael-fenok-istwyn-tamius-jorath-oliion